Current State Assessment

  1. Reflect on your current role: Take stock of your current responsibilities, skills, and accomplishments as a video content creator.
  2. Identify strengths and weaknesses: Be honest about your areas of expertise and where you need improvement.
  3. Analyze industry trends: Research the latest developments in video content creation, including new technologies, platforms, and best practices.

Career Goals and Objectives

  1. Define your short-term goals (next 6-12 months): What do you want to achieve in your current role or a new one? (e.g., increase video production efficiency, expand your skill set, or take on more responsibility).
  2. Set long-term goals (1-3 years): Where do you see yourself in the future? (e.g., lead a team, specialize in a niche, or start your own production company).
  3. Make your goals SMART: Ensure they are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ound.

Skill Development and Training

  1. Stay up-to-date with industry software and tools: Familiarize yourself with the latest video editing software, camera technology, and other equipment.
  2. Expand your skill set: Consider acquiring skills in areas like:
    • Motion graphics and animation
    • Color grading and color correction
    • Sound design and audio mixing
    • Scriptwriting and storytelling
    • Project management and team leadership
  3. Online courses and tutorials: Websites like Udemy, LinkedIn Learning, and Skillshare offer a wide range of courses on video production and related topics.
  4. Attend workshops and conferences: Network with peers, learn from industry experts, and stay informed about the latest trends and best practices.

Networking and Community Building

  1. Join online communities: Participate in forums like Reddit's r/videoediting, r/filmmaking, and LinkedIn groups dedicated to video content creation.
  2. Attend industry events: Conferences, meetups, and workshops provide opportunities to network with other professionals, learn about new developments, and potentially find new job opportunities.
  3. Collaborate with other creators: Partner with fellow video content creators on projects to build your network, gain experience, and showcase your work.

Personal Branding and Marketing

  1. Develop a professional online presence: Create a personal website or portfolio showcasing your work, skills, and experience.
  2. Establish a social media presence: Leverage platforms like LinkedIn, Twitter, or Instagram to share your work, engage with your audience, and promote your services.
  3. Build a personal brand: Define your unique value proposition, and consistently communicate it across all your online platforms.

Career Advancement Strategies

  1. Seek feedback and mentorship: Ask for constructive feedback from peers, mentors, or supervisors to help you grow and improve.
  2. Take on new challenges: Volunteer for projects or tasks that push you out of your comfort zone and help you develop new skills.
  3. Consider freelancing or consulting: Offer your services on a freelance or consulting basis to gain experience, build your network, and potentially find new job opportunities.

Action Plan and Timeline

  1. Create a 30-60-90 day plan: Outline specific actions you'll take to achieve your short-term goals.
  2. Set deadlines and milestones: Break down larger goals into smaller, manageable tasks, and track your progress.
  3. Regularly review and adjust: Periodically assess your progress, adjust your plan as needed, and celebrate your achievements.

By following this guide, you'll be well on your way to updating your video content creator career and setting yourself up for success in the ever-evolving world of video production.

In 2026, the video content creator career has evolved from a focus on viral "influence" to a creative entrepreneurship model. The industry is now a billion-dollar economy where individual skill and strategic niche authority outweigh raw follower counts. Core Pillars of a 2026 Career Strategy

Authenticity Over AI Perfection: Audiences in 2026 value "human" content—behind-the-scenes, raw storytelling, and relatable moments—over perfectly polished or generic AI-generated videos.

Multi-Platform Ecosystem: Relying on one platform is considered high-risk. Successful creators maintain a presence across at least two platforms (e.g., YouTube and TikTok) to protect against algorithm shifts.

AI as a "Teammate": AI has moved from a competitor to a production assistant. It is now the baseline for handling repetitive tasks like transcript-based editing, real-time translation, and sound design.

Community-First Monetization: Direct-to-audience revenue (memberships, gated content, and digital products) is preferred over unpredictable platform ad revenue. High-Demand Specialized Paths

To stay "up-to-date," creators are moving away from chasing viral moments and toward building a structured business: Essential Skills:

Multi-Platform Strategy: Adapting content specifically for TikTok (discovery), Instagram (engagement), and YouTube (evergreen search) rather than just cross-posting the same clip. The "Minimalist" Gear Setup:

Visuals: High-end smartphones are now the industry standard for most creators; lighting and stabilization (tripods) are more critical than expensive cameras.

Audio: Audiences in 2026 will "flee content with static" instantly. A basic external microphone is cited as the #1 most important early investment. Common Software Tools:

Editing: CapCut and Descript for fast, mobile-friendly or text-based workflows.

Planning: Notion for organization and Hootsuite for scheduling. Monetization Trends

The path to a full-time income in 2026 often involves diversified streams rather than just ad revenue:

UGC (User-Generated Content): Brands are hiring creators to film authentic-looking "home-style" videos for their own channels.

Digital Products: Selling exclusive training modules, guides, or community access via platforms like Substack or Discord.
